Yuji Matsubara is a scholar working on Surgery, Pathology and Forensic Medicine and Pharmacology. According to data from OpenAlex, Yuji Matsubara has authored 37 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 22 papers in Surgery, 21 papers in Pathology and Forensic Medicine and 9 papers in Pharmacology. Recurrent topics in Yuji Matsubara's work include Spine and Intervertebral Disc Pathology (21 papers), Spinal Fractures and Fixation Techniques (9 papers) and Musculoskeletal pain and rehabilitation (8 papers). Yuji Matsubara is often cited by papers focused on Spine and Intervertebral Disc Pathology (21 papers), Spinal Fractures and Fixation Techniques (9 papers) and Musculoskeletal pain and rehabilitation (8 papers). Yuji Matsubara collaborates with scholars based in Japan, Greece and Switzerland. Yuji Matsubara's co-authors include Naoki Ishiguro, Tokumi Kanemura, Shiro Imagama, Fumihiko Kato, Yasutsugu Yukawa, Kei Ando, Koji Sato, Noriaki Kawakami, Tetsuya Ohara and Taichi Tsuji and has published in prestigious journals such as Spine, Journal of Thrombosis and Haemostasis and BioMed Research International.
